3D Animation: A Beginner's Guide to Production
Embarking on the journey of 3D animation can feel challenging, but with a fundamental understanding of the process, it’s surprisingly accessible. This primer will briefly outline the key stages involved. Initially, you'll need to pick a suitable program , such as Blender (free!), Maya, or 3ds Max. Modeling is the first significant component; this involves building the computer objects and characters that will populate your environment . Next comes defining, which is the technique of creating a structure for your models so they can be posed and animated. Then, the here compelling part: movement ! This involves setting keyframes and manipulating the position of your objects over time . Finally, exporting transforms your 3D scene into a finished video.

Achieving a Pixar-Inspired Look in Your Animation
To replicate that iconic Pixar aesthetic, focus on several vital elements. Initially, prioritize strong character sculpting. Think beyond simple shapes; embrace subtle forms and carefully explore silhouette. Then, pay particular attention to lighting. Pixar films are known for their beautiful and complex lighting setups, using ambient and cool tones to create mood. Finally, master the technique of producing believable material properties; imperfections and minor variations are crucial for realism – don't strive for sterile flawlessness.
